Two charged plates `A` and `B` are at the same electrical potential, and parallel and separated by a distance `d.` A unifrom magnetic induction field `B` acts perpendicular to plane of paper (and parallel to plates)n between the plates. Particels,each with charge `q`, mass `m` and kinetic energy `K` are shot throgh a hole in `A` directly towards `B`, each particle entering the hole perpendicular to `A`, An ammeter `AM` connected to an electrical network is connected to `B` and measures the current collected by the plate `B`, as the particles hit it. The limited value of the fied `B` for which the ammeter will stop showing a current is

A

`(sqrt(2mK))/(qd)`

B

`(sqrt(3mK))/(qd)`

C

`(sqrt(mK))/(qd)`

D

`(2sqrt(mK))/(qd)`

The correct Answer is:
A

Obviously for the limiting field, the path of the particles will be semi`-` circular arcs of radius equal to the distance between the plates.

`(i.e.)` radius r of circular path is `r=d`
Now for a particle of charge q, mass m and kinetic energy K, where velocity `upsilon=u upsilon=sqrt((2K)/(m))`
r is `r=(m upsilon)/(qB)=(m)/(qB)sqrt((2K)/(m))`
Hence, `B=(m)/(qd)sqrt((2K)/(m))=(sqrt(2mK))/(qd)`
